Opened in 1905, it has been a quintessential part of Merseyside's transport network, connecting the community with major cities and surrounding areas.
The station provides essential facilities to ensure passengers have a smooth and comfortable journey. The ticket office operates from early morning till midnight on weekdays and weekends, although ticket machines are not available. However, tickets purchased online can easily be collected from the ticket office. Accessibility is prioritized here with step-free access throughout, and ramps are available for train access. Unfortunately, despite full station access, there aren't any accessible ticket machines or toilets, although assistance can be requested via the Passenger Assist service.
For those traveling by car, the station offers a free car park with 48 spaces, including 5 dedicated to accessible parking. Cycling enthusiasts can also benefit from 34 bicycle storage spaces. Though there are no shops or refreshment areas at the station, Seaforth & Litherland ensures a secure environment with CCTV monitoring across the station.
Connecting with other transport modes is straightforward. Although there's no direct taxi rank, the nearby bus services ensure seamless travel to your next destination. For precise bus routes or schedules, passengers can visit Merseytravel or contact Traveline. Additionally, for travelers needing to catch a flight,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is accessible from Liverpool South Parkway station via the 86A or 80A bus, with tickets available that cover both train and bus segments.
The station also accommodates rail replacement services, with pick-up points at Seaforth Road, making it easy during planned maintenance or unexpected disruptions.

Aylesbury Vale Parkway is equipped to meet the needs of a diverse array of travelers. For those needing to purchase or collect tickets, there is a ticket office open from early morning to early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ays. If you're arriving on a Sunday, you won't find staff at the ticket office, but ticket machines are conveniently available for in-person purchase and collection of tickets bought online. Accessibility is a priority at the station, with step-free access throughout and an induction loop system available for those with hearing impairments.
Though there are no shops or ATM facilities on site, essential amenities such as waiting rooms are accessible during ticket office hours. Also, the station building houses toilets and baby changing facilities. For those traveling with bicycles, Aylesbury Vale Parkway provides ample storage space with 80 bicycle stands and additional motorcycle parking. However, there are no cycle hire facilities available.
Beyond exploring Aylesbury, the station offers seamless transport connections. Rail replacement buses operate from the main bus stop just 50 meters from the station. Planning an onward journey?
